Ben Levi Ross Biography

Ben Levi Ross is a singer-actor from the United States most well-known performance was as an understudy for the Broadway parts of Evan, Connor, and Jared as well as Evan in the national tour of the Tony Award-winning musical Dear Evan Hansen.

How old is Levi Ross? Age

The Dear Evan Hansen star is 26 years old as of 15 January 2024. He was born in 1998 in Santa Monica, California, United States.

Ben Levi Ross Family – Education

Ross was raised in a Jewish home. He participated actively in the school’s theater program while attending Santa Monica High School. As part of the 2016 U.S. Presidential Scholars Program, he was named a Presidential Scholar of the Arts in 2016. Additionally, he was a 2016 Music Center Spotlight Awards grand prize finalist. He spent a year and a half at Carnegie Mellon University after graduating from high school.

Levi Ross Dear Evan Hansen

In addition to portraying Evan Hansen on the US Tour, he understudied Connor Murphy, Jared Kleinman, and Evan Hansen in the Broadway production.Following its Off-Broadway run at Second Stage Theatre from March to May 2016 and its world premiere at Arena Stage in Washington, D.C. in July 2015, the musical had its Broadway debut at the Music Box Theatre in December of 2016. September 18, 2022, was the last day of the show. The show won praise from critics. It received nine nominations for the 71st Tony Awards; it took home six of them, including Best Musical, Best Book, Best Score, Best Actor (Ben Platt), and Best Featured Actress (Rachel Bay Jones).

The musical’s US tour, which features Ben Levi Ross in the lead role, kicked up at the Denver Center for the Performing Arts’ Buell Theatre in October 2018. With Jessica Phillips playing Heidi Hansen, Jared Goldsmith playing Jared Kleinman, and Phoebe Koyabe playing Alana Beck, the tour was slated to visit more than 50 locations. Max McKenna as Zoe Murphy, Christiane Noll as Cynthia Murphy, Aaron Lazar as Larry Murphy, Marrick Smith as Connor Murphy, and Stephen Christopher Anthony as the stand-in Evan Hansen were among the other cast members.

Levi Ross Tick, Tick… Boom!

Ross appeared as Freddy, a fellow waiter at the Moondance Diner and Jonathan’s friend in the 2021 American biographical musical film Tick, Tick… Boom!.
